Understanding State Farm and Its Offerings
State Farm is a mutual insurance company, meaning it is owned by its policyholders. This structure often allows the company to prioritize the needs of its customers over the pursuit of profits. With a vast network of agents and a strong financial standing, State Farm has earned a reputation for its customer service, financial stability, and commitment to community involvement.
State Farm offers a comprehensive range of insurance products, catering to various needs:
- Auto Insurance: This covers financial losses resulting from accidents, theft, or other incidents involving your vehicle. Coverage options include liability, collision, comprehensive, and uninsured/underinsured motorist protection.
- Homeowners Insurance: This protects your home and belongings from damage caused by covered perils, such as fire, windstorms, and theft. It also provides liability coverage if someone is injured on your property.
- Renters Insurance: This safeguards your personal belongings and provides liability coverage if you rent an apartment or home.
- Life Insurance: This provides financial security for your loved ones in the event of your death. State Farm offers various life insurance policies, including term life, whole life, and universal life.
- Health Insurance: State Farm offers various health insurance plans through its partnerships with health insurance providers.
- Business Insurance: This protects businesses from various risks, including property damage, liability claims, and business interruption.
Factors Influencing State Farm Insurance Quotes
Several factors influence the cost of your State Farm insurance quote. Understanding these factors can help you anticipate the premium you will be charged and take steps to potentially lower your costs.
- Type of Insurance: The type of insurance you need will significantly impact the cost. For example, auto insurance premiums tend to be higher than renters insurance premiums due to the higher risk associated with driving.
- Coverage Limits and Deductibles: The amount of coverage you choose and the deductible you select will directly affect your premium. Higher coverage limits and lower deductibles typically result in higher premiums, while lower coverage limits and higher deductibles lead to lower premiums.
- Location: Your location plays a crucial role in determining your insurance premiums. Factors such as the crime rate in your area, the frequency of natural disasters, and the cost of living can influence the cost of insurance.
- Driving Record (for Auto Insurance): Your driving history is a critical factor in determining your auto insurance premiums. A clean driving record with no accidents or traffic violations will typically result in lower premiums. Conversely, a history of accidents, speeding tickets, or DUI convictions can significantly increase your premiums.
- Age and Experience (for Auto Insurance): Younger drivers and those with less driving experience are generally considered higher risk and may face higher premiums. As drivers gain experience and establish a safe driving record, their premiums may decrease.
- Vehicle Type (for Auto Insurance): The make, model, and age of your vehicle can influence your auto insurance premiums. More expensive vehicles and those with a higher risk of theft or damage may result in higher premiums.
- Home Features (for Homeowners Insurance): Certain features of your home, such as the presence of a swimming pool, a trampoline, or a security system, can affect your homeowners insurance premiums.
- Credit Score: Many insurance companies, including State Farm, consider your credit score when determining your premiums. A higher credit score often indicates a lower risk, potentially leading to lower premiums.
- Claims History: Your claims history can impact your insurance premiums. Filing multiple claims, even for minor incidents, may result in higher premiums.
- Discounts: State Farm offers various discounts that can help you lower your premiums. These may include discounts for:
- Bundling: Combining multiple insurance policies, such as auto and homeowners insurance.
- Good Student: For students with good grades.
- Defensive Driving Course: Completing a defensive driving course.
- Vehicle Safety Features: Vehicles equipped with safety features, such as anti-lock brakes and airbags.
- Loyalty: For long-term customers.
How to Obtain a State Farm Insurance Quote
Obtaining a State Farm insurance quote is a straightforward process. You can get a quote through the following methods:
- Online: State Farm’s website provides a user-friendly online quote tool. You can enter your information and receive an instant quote.
- By Phone: You can call a State Farm agent directly and provide the necessary information to receive a quote.
- In Person: Visit a local State Farm agent’s office to discuss your insurance needs and obtain a quote.
When requesting a quote, be prepared to provide the following information:
- Personal Information: Your name, address, date of birth, and contact information.
- Vehicle Information (for Auto Insurance): The make, model, year, and VIN of your vehicle.
- Home Information (for Homeowners Insurance): The address of your property, the square footage, and the year it was built.
- Driving History (for Auto Insurance): Your driving record, including any accidents or traffic violations.
- Coverage Needs: The type of insurance you need and the desired coverage limits and deductibles.
Tips for Lowering Your State Farm Insurance Premiums
While insurance is a necessity, there are several strategies you can employ to potentially lower your State Farm insurance premiums:
- Bundle Your Policies: Combine your auto and homeowners or renters insurance policies to qualify for a multi-policy discount.
- Increase Your Deductible: Opt for a higher deductible, which will reduce your premium. However, ensure you can comfortably afford the deductible in the event of a claim.
- Maintain a Clean Driving Record: Drive safely and avoid accidents and traffic violations to keep your auto insurance premiums low.
- Take Advantage of Discounts: Inquire about available discounts and ensure you are taking advantage of all the discounts for which you qualify.
- Improve Your Credit Score: Work on improving your credit score, as this can positively impact your insurance premiums.
- Review Your Coverage Regularly: Periodically review your insurance coverage to ensure it still meets your needs and that you are not overpaying.
- Shop Around and Compare Quotes: Although you may prefer State Farm, it’s always a good idea to compare quotes from other insurance providers to ensure you’re getting the best rates and coverage.
- Consider Safety Features: If you’re purchasing a new car, choose one with safety features like anti-lock brakes, airbags, and anti-theft devices.
